Anchor is an app prototype that serves as a one-stop platform for students navigating their internship journey — job listings, mentorship opportunities, career events, and more.
The idea sparked from gaps in the tools students currently use. We dug into user research to understand their struggles, from fragmented resources to the stress of tracking applications.
From there, we sketched ideas, built wireframes, and tested prototypes to bring Anchor to life.
The goal? Make internships easier, more accessible, and a lot less stressful.

For our final project in Intro to Computer Science, my team and I created a Python-based Hangman game. It was all about guessing letters to reveal a hidden word, with features like progress tracking and input validation to keep things smooth and fun. I focused on designing the game logic and writing clean, efficient code while collaborating with teammates to bring it all together. This project was a great introduction to coding and teamwork, setting the foundation for the skills I’m building now as a master’s student in HCI.
